Gogglebox star Helena Worthington has provided a rare and intimate glimpse into her domestic life with her off-screen partner, Dan, following the recent arrival of their second child. The Channel 4 personality, who joined the beloved reality show in 2017 alongside her parents Alison and George, welcomed a baby girl just weeks ago, adding to her family with son Edwin.

Keeping Her Private Life Under Wraps
Despite her public role on Gogglebox, Helena has consistently maintained privacy around her relationship with Dan, who does not appear on the show. In a previous interview with ilovemanchester.com, she described Dan as her biggest influencer, stating, "My partner Dan, he is an amazing artist and has always supported me wholeheartedly." She has also addressed the decision to keep their relationship private, noting, "FYI – not that this should matter! I am not 18 I am 29 and my baby does have a father, but I wish to keep that side of my life private."
Navigating Joy and Grief
Helena announced her pregnancy last year, but the joyous news was tempered by the devastating loss of her grandmother, which led her to withdraw from filming the final episode of Gogglebox's series. In a heartfelt social media post, she shared, "I lost my legendary nana, and because of that I won't be filming the last episode of Gogglebox this series." She fondly recalled her grandmother as a sharp, hilarious woman who never missed a chance to boast about her family's TV appearance.
She added, "I'm expecting a baby girl in the next month, and my heart aches knowing my nana won't get to meet her. But I know she'll be part of her in so many ways - in stories, in humour, and in that same strength and warmth." Life Beyond the Screen
Away from television, Helena, based in Manchester, is an accomplished artist specialising in sculpting and painting. Her family life now centres on raising her two children, with Dan playing a supportive role behind the scenes.
